Pork, fresh, loin, sirloin (chops), boneless, separable lean and fat, cooked, broiled: nutrition facts
A 100 g serving of Pork, fresh, loin, sirloin (chops), boneless, separable lean and fat, cooked, broiled has 170 calories. About 0% of those calories come from carbohydrates, 69% from protein and 31% from fat.

Nutrition facts per 100 g
| Nutrient | Amount |
|---|---|
| Calories | 170 kcal |
| Protein | 28.19 g |
| Total fat | 5.53 g |
| Saturated fat | 1.79 g |
| Carbohydrates | 0 g |
| Fiber | 0 g |
| Sugars | 0 g |
| Sodium | 65 mg |
| Potassium | 420 mg |
| Cholesterol | 76 mg |
| Calcium | 11 mg |
| Iron | 0.87 mg |
Nutrition per serving
| Serving | Weight | Calories | Protein | Carbs | Fat |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 3 oz | 85 g | 145 | 24 g | 0 g | 4.7 g |
| 1 chop | 159 g | 270 | 44.8 g | 0 g | 8.8 g |
Values are averages from USDA FoodData Central and vary by brand, ripeness and preparation. This is general information, not medical or dietary advice.
